Contract NNL13AA09C
Smithsonian Institution · National Aeronautics And Space Administration · September 30, 2020
Smithsonian Institution was awarded a federal contract by National Aeronautics And Space Administration on September 30, 2020 for $5.66 million of work in research and development in the physical, engineering, and life sciences (except biotechnology). Performance is in Cambridge, MA. It was awarded under full and open competition. The contract has been modified 9 times since the base award It uses cost-plus contract pricing. The most recent modification was on December 17, 2025. If all options are exercised, the contract could reach $35.22 million.
